29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ee(s) eng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els were not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system, nor were employee(s) provided with an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b): a) 109 Gordon Avenue, Syracuse, NY 13207: On or about July 15, 2022, the employer failed to ensure their employee was protected by guardrail systems, safety net systems, or a personal fall arrest system, while the employee was performing residential construction on the roof on a two story house. |

29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(1): Where portable ladders were used for access to an upper landing surface and the ladder's length allows, the ladder side rails did not extend at least 3 feet (.9 m) above the upper landing surface being accessed: a) 109 Gordon Avenue, Syracuse, NY 13207: On or about July 15, 2022, when an employee was accessing a roof with a portable ladder, the employer did not ensure the ladder's side rails extended at least 3 feet above the upper landing surface being accessed. |
